From e256a4b20ab92ea7ab6baf3a0e5ebad2c835cfbf Mon Sep 17 00:00:00 2001
From: xiaoyong931011 <15274802129@163.com>
Date: Fri, 23 Dec 2022 16:39:20 +0800
Subject: [PATCH] 20221221

---
 src/main/java/cc/mrbird/febs/mall/vo/TeamListVo.java                      |    3 +++
 src/main/resources/mapper/modules/MallMemberMapper.xml                    |    4 ++--
 src/main/resources/templates/febs/views/modules/mallMember/agentList.html |    2 +-
 3 files changed, 6 insertions(+), 3 deletions(-)

diff --git a/src/main/java/cc/mrbird/febs/mall/vo/TeamListVo.java b/src/main/java/cc/mrbird/febs/mall/vo/TeamListVo.java
index 0a73aa2..5e8812e 100644
--- a/src/main/java/cc/mrbird/febs/mall/vo/TeamListVo.java
+++ b/src/main/java/cc/mrbird/febs/mall/vo/TeamListVo.java
@@ -50,4 +50,7 @@
     @ApiModelProperty(value = "用户等级")
     private String accountLevel;
 
+    @ApiModelProperty(value = "代理等级")
+    private String level;
+
 }
diff --git a/src/main/resources/mapper/modules/MallMemberMapper.xml b/src/main/resources/mapper/modules/MallMemberMapper.xml
index de1dd5f..8923899 100644
--- a/src/main/resources/mapper/modules/MallMemberMapper.xml
+++ b/src/main/resources/mapper/modules/MallMemberMapper.xml
@@ -78,13 +78,13 @@
             a.phone,
             a.invite_id,
             a.account_level,
+            a.level,
             2 isCurrent,
             a.created_time,
             (select sum(e.amount)
              from mall_order_info e
                       inner join mall_member b on e.member_id=b.ID
-                      inner join mall_order_item c on e.id = c.order_id -- and c.is_normal=2
-             where e.status = 4 and (b.invite_id=a.invite_id or b.referrer_id=a.invite_id)) amount,
+             where e.status = 4 and find_in_set(a.invite_id, b.referrer_ids)) amount,
             (select count(1) from mall_order_info b
                       inner join mall_member e on e.id=b.member_id and b.status = 4
              where find_in_set(a.invite_id, e.referrer_ids)) orderCnt,
diff --git a/src/main/resources/templates/febs/views/modules/mallMember/agentList.html b/src/main/resources/templates/febs/views/modules/mallMember/agentList.html
index d9accbc..4924c74 100644
--- a/src/main/resources/templates/febs/views/modules/mallMember/agentList.html
+++ b/src/main/resources/templates/febs/views/modules/mallMember/agentList.html
@@ -134,7 +134,7 @@
                     {field: 'name', title: '名称', minWidth: 100,align:'left'},
                     {field: 'inviteId', title: '邀请码', minWidth: 100,align:'left'},
                     {field: 'levelName', title: '代理层级', minWidth: 100,align:'left'},
-                    {field: 'memberNum', title: '下级', minWidth: 100,align:'left'},
+                    // {field: 'memberNum', title: '下级', minWidth: 100,align:'left'},
                     {field: 'allMemberNum', title: '我的团队总数', minWidth: 100,align:'left'},
                     {field: 'amount', title: '团队业绩', minWidth: 100,align:'left'},
                     {title: '操作',

--
Gitblit v1.9.1